> Can you open the message that has the attachment? If so, click the
> paperclip near the top right corner of the message that is supposed
> to give you options for the attachment, and record the file name.
> If it's winmail.dat, you'll probably have to install Outlook (not Outlook
> Express) to be able to open the attachment. If it's anything else,
> tell us the part of its filename starting with the last period and we may
> be able to help with that file type.
